In FLAC, the "wall of sound" on A Hard Day’s Night is no longer a muddy blur. You hear the thwack of Ringo’s drum skin and the woody decay of Paul’s Höfner bass. The 2009 mono FLACs (yes, the original mono mixes) are the gold standard here. The stereo FLACs of this era are often gimmicky (drums in one ear, vocals in the other), but in lossless quality, at least the separation is clean gimmickry.
